The bond of friendship

Remember that tree we used to climb
Held up by the hardened ground and time
Even through the stormiest weather
The base of it still stayed together
When younger trees grew up around it
It still stood tall just like we found it
Its drained branches are now old and worn
Its gray moss and bark faded and torn
It reminds me of our strong, weathered bond
And when we leave, this tree will carry on
